Improved Energy Efficiency

Double glazing can boost the energy efficiency of your home, while reducing carbon footprint and energy bills. This is especially true of high-quality argon gas-filled units that help to keep heat and keep homes warmer for longer. This could save homeowners money over the years.

Old windows can permit more heat to escape, and if they're not properly insulated, they could cause higher energy bills than they are required. Double-glazed windows are a great way to upgrade older properties. They look stunning and will help lower energy costs.

The u-value of energy efficient doors and frames is rated based on how easily heat can be transferred through the glass or frame. The lower the u value the more efficient the window is in energy efficiency. Many homeowners choose to install windows that are energy efficient because of the savings they get on their utility bills.

It is difficult to retrofit double glass to sash windows, especially in conservation areas since this could alter the appearance of the building and lead to problems like drafts. However, secondary glazing is a viable alternative for older sash windows, which can significantly improve the energy efficiency of a home without affecting the original design. Secondary glazing can help reduce energy bills, heating costs and improve the value of your property.

Greater Comfort

A key benefit of double glazing is a more comfortable home, especially in winter. The loss of heat through windows is an important factor in the rise in heating expenses, however it can be minimised with double glazing that keeps hot air in your property and blocks cold air from getting into.

This will reduce the need for artificial heating and cooling which can help you save money on energy costs. Double glazing can reduce outside noise which allows you to relax in a quieter space.

Insulation is essential in reducing heat transmission through glass. The space that is insulated between the two double-glazed panes slows down heat transfer from the warmer interior towards the cooler exterior. The argon layer between the panes reduces thermal transfer by 34% in comparison to air.
